来源:小编 更新:2024-09-13 04:28:28
用手机看
随着移动互联网的快速发展,APP游戏市场日益繁荣。一款成功的APP游戏不仅需要吸引人的创意,还需要精湛的技术实现。本文将为您详细介绍APP游戏开发的整个流程,从创意构思到上线运营,助您成为游戏开发高手。
1. 市场调研
在开始游戏开发之前,首先要进行市场调研,了解当前游戏市场的趋势、用户需求以及竞争对手的情况。这有助于确定游戏类型、题材和目标用户群体。
2. 创意构思
根据市场调研结果,结合自身优势,构思游戏的核心玩法、故事情节、角色设定等。创意构思是游戏开发的基础,决定了游戏的独特性和吸引力。
3. 游戏原型
将创意构思转化为游戏原型,包括游戏界面、操作方式、关卡设计等。游戏原型有助于验证创意的可行性,并为后续开发提供参考。
1. 开发平台
选择合适的开发平台是游戏开发的关键。目前主流的开发平台有Uiy、Ureal Egie、Cocos2d-x等。根据游戏类型、性能需求等因素选择合适的平台。
2. 开发工具
选择合适的开发工具可以提高开发效率。常见的开发工具有Visual Sudio、Xcode、Eclipse等。根据开发平台选择相应的开发工具。
3. 技术框架
选择合适的技术框架可以简化开发过程,提高代码质量。例如,Uiy游戏开发可以使用C语言,Ureal Egie可以使用C++或蓝图。
1. 角色设计
根据游戏题材和角色设定,设计游戏中的角色形象。角色设计要符合游戏风格,具有辨识度。
2. 场景设计
设计游戏场景,包括背景图、地图元素等。场景设计要具有吸引力,为玩家提供沉浸式体验。
3. UI设计
设计游戏的用户界面,包括菜单、按钮、游戏界面等。UI设计要简洁、美观,方便玩家操作。
1. 游戏逻辑
根据游戏设计,编写游戏的逻辑代码,包括玩家操作、游戏物理效果、碰撞检测等。
2. 数据存储
设计游戏数据存储方案,包括本地存储、云存储等。确保游戏数据的安全性和稳定性。
3. 性能优化
对游戏进行性能优化,提高游戏运行速度和稳定性。优化内容包括内存管理、渲染优化等。
1. 单元测试
对游戏中的各个模块进行单元测试,确保功能正常运行。
2. 集成测试
对游戏的整体功能进行测试,确保各个模块之间协同工作。
3. 性能测试
对游戏进行性能测试,确保游戏在多种设备上都能流畅运行。
4. 调试
根据测试结果,对游戏进行调试,修复bug,优化性能。
1. 渠道推广
选择合适的推广渠道,如应用商店、社交媒体、游戏论坛等,提高游戏知名度。
2. 用户反馈
关注用户反馈,及时优化游戏,提高用户满意度。
3. 数据分析
对游戏数据进行分析,了解用户行为,为后续优化提供依据。
4. 持续更新
根据市场变化和用户需求,持续更新游戏,保持游戏活力。
APP游戏开发是一个复杂的过程,需要创意、技术、美术等多方面的协同。通过以上步骤,您可以完成一款成功的APP游戏。祝您在游戏开发的道路上越走越远!
标签:APP游戏开发 游戏开发流程 创意构思 技术选型 美术设计 程序开发 测试与调试 上线运营